Flutter-strated with the ecosystem
Luker for a long time.I've been working on an app for about 12 months in what little spare time 2020 afforded. It's not particularly complex, I had a rough concept done in less than a week (and build much more challenging programs at work in other languages).But as I pushed the app toward something really usable - I've been very frustrated with what seems like a poor quality control in the ecosystem. There are new build issues every month even without code-changes on my end. Updating flutter itself changes the behavior seemingly stable widgets (Stack w/non-positioned elements for example). 3rd party libs work, or don't.Yesterday I lost my development partner, who was handling iOS integration, to these frustrations.Even things like basic documentation aren't reliable from the flutter team itselfex: https://imgur.com/a/KgKsmYNI'm spending 80+% of my time dealing with what seems like a alpha-stage ecosystem. It likely would have been easier to develop my app in native code. I'd have been done in 1/2 the time if I'd gone the RN route.I really wanted to like flutter but it's just not there. I want to be wrong about this. I'm super bummed. What am I missing? What's the killer feature that makes this pain worthwhile?

How do you use BLoC?
I've been developing with Flutter for 1.5 years now.And I've been using BLoC all the time.It's a great tool, but there are some disadvantages, and I would like to know how you overcome them.How do you handle Forms?
Personally, I create BLoC with single state, which contains all the necessary fields. And use freezed's copyWith.How do you handle highly overloaded screens?
Tutorials are always good on paper. But sometimes (either designer is bad at UX, or business requires it) it's not possible to just write single bloc per item on the screen - I personally needed to store some common information in parent BLoC, and create multiple child BLoC, which are listened by the parent.How do you struggle with name collisions?
When project is large, you can't name states as Loading, Success and Error. You always have to prefix them with the name of the BLoC. The larger the project, the longer the prefix.Partly, freezed solves this problem with unions, and here comes the 4th question.Is inconsistency acceptable in your projects?
Yes, freezed is awesome for defining states and events, but sometimes you need to react to the same state twice, but freezed automatically overrides equality for union's parts. So I always ended up with defining old-way states with prefixes, creating inconsistency in codebase.

Generate a .pfx certificate for Flutter windows MSIX lib.
Hi Fluter devs,I came across this lib for Flutter Windows build that helps you to create MSIX Installer for direct install as well as for Windows Store.
But what is lacking, is the way to build the .pfx certificate that is kind of equal to the .keystore file in Android apps for signing Release build.Without a .pfx certificate, you can't install the windows app on a computer with MSIX Installer. And on Internet, it is all confusing and out-dated.So, I have created a simplified step-by-step post to generate .pfx Certificate. here.Hope it helps everyone.
